  • Nicole Young has known Oppenheim founder and president Jason Oppenheim for 15 years, and apparently once dated him, according to her co-cast member Amanza Smith
  • The former marketing consultant, who has sold US$100 million worth of property, initially agreed to join the show in its inaugural season, but got cold feet – now she’s joining seasons 6 and 7

Hit reality TV show Selling Sunset is finally back for its sixth instalment on Netflix! Last we heard, our favourite property agent Christine Quinn, the glamorous villain, had been fired from the Oppenheim Group and consequently left the show.

Fortunately for viewers, the producers have brought in two new faces to the high-end property brokerage, Nicole Young and Bre Tiesi, who are set to shake up the show’s dynamics.

After five seasons of tension between Quinn and cast member Chrishell Stause, there still seems to be no rest from drama for the latter. The trailer for season six, which aired on May 19, already showed glimpses of tension between Stause and newbie Young, who is ready to step into Quinn’s shoes.

But just who is Young? Here’s what we know about her.

Nicole Young is a seasoned property agent

Young, 37, hails from Minnesota and attended Baylor University in Texas where she studied marketing and public relations, per People. She initially worked as a marketing consultant before making her way into the property business.

She started working at the Oppenheim brokerage in Los Angeles in 2014 and has been a part of the team for almost a decade.

She has sold US$100 million worth of property, according to Deadline, and is the brokerage’s longest-standing and highest-paid agent.
